About White Collar Charges

Fraud ▪ Embezzlement ▪ Internet crimes ▪ Identity theft ▪ Forgery

Charges for white collar crimes often come down to the opinion of law enforcement or the prosecutor's case. They can make serious errors, including not having probable cause to make the arrest, collecting evidence illegally, and disregarding your right to privacy or to carry on your business.
